On 08/21/14 15:54, David Palao wrote:
> But I'm interested in a "genuine"
> C++ project: some task where C++ is really THE language (and where
> python is actually a bad ab initio choice)

For my day job, I chose Qt on C++ for a classic desktop app that needs
to be deployed on Windows (among other platforms) with an installation
package that is as small as possible.

All I need to do deployment-wise is to create an NSIS script putting a
couple of DLL's and my executable in a folder in %ProgramFiles% and a
shortcutin start menu. The full package is 5 megs and the update archive
is pushing half a megabyte.
